How Do Dermatologists Without Insurance Work?
The increasing number of uninsured individuals in the US, combined with the high cost of medical care, has led to a growing demand for affordable dermatological services. With the rising cost of healthcare, many people are finding it difficult to prioritize their skin health, leading to a higher incidence of skin problems such as acne, psoriasis, and skin cancers.
To find a dermatologist without insurance, start by searching online for dermatologists in your area who offer cash-pay or self-pay services. You can also check with local hospitals or clinics to see if they offer dermatological services on a cash-pay basis. Many dermatologists also offer free or low-cost consultations to discuss treatment options and estimate costs.
A dermatologist without insurance typically refers to a healthcare professional who provides skin care services on a cash-pay or self-pay basis. This means that patients pay the full cost of treatment upfront, rather than relying on insurance reimbursement. Dermatologists without insurance often operate on a sliding scale fee, taking into account the patient's income and ability to pay. They may also offer package deals or discounts for multiple treatments.
